I can give you a little info. Westgate Vacation Villas and Westlake Towncenter are very close to Disney. We have never had a problem getting there. Sure, there is lots of traffic on 192, but they have put a light in and that helps. I would say it takes us an average of 10-15 minutes tops from the condo to DW. The Villas have tons of pools and I think the Towncenter has plenty also. We prefer Villas b/c they are only 2 stories, you can generally get a place right outside your unit and you don't have to worry about waiting for an elevator. The Towncenter is newer, though. Stay away from the sales people and it should be fine.

there is an easy short cut to WDW from Westgate - just go down the road (entry point) - and go straight across US 192 - it is now Sherberth - the short cut to WDW - after around a mile (really a little less) - you will come to a traffic light - turn left you are at AKL - turn right and follow the signs to where in WDW you want to go.

I just returned from Westgate Villas this past weekend. Overall I had no complaints about the place on this visit or past trips. It was very clean and I like that it is so close to Disney. I booked my room off my entertainment card so I was not there on any time share special price or anything. I believe we paid 129.00 a night plus tax with the entertainment card. Nobody called us to try and get us to do any presentations at all. When we checked in they were going to get someone to show us to our room and I declined. I had a map and I have been there before so how hard can it be? I wonder if they try getting you that way? Anyhow I have stayed at worse places and it was nice to have the room for everyone.
